How To Fix /PM0/ABQ_MANMIG_GUI003 - Policy &1 does not exist


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/PM0/ABQ_MANMIG_GUI -

  • Message number: 003

  • Message text: Policy &1 does not exist

    The SAP error message /PM0/ABQ_MANMIG_GUI003 Policy &1 does not exist typically occurs in the context of the SAP Policy Management module, particularly when dealing with policy migration or management tasks. This error indicates that the system is unable to find a policy that is referenced by the identifier &1.

    Cause:

    1. Non-Existent Policy: The policy referenced by the identifier does not exist in the system. This could be due to a typo in the policy ID or the policy not being created or activated.
    2.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or access the specified policy.
    3.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the database or issues with the data migration process that led to the policy being unavailable.
    4. Configuration Issues: The system may not be properly configured to recognize the policy, especially if it was recently created or modified.

    Solution:

    1. Verify Policy ID: Check the policy ID referenced in the error message. Ensure that it is correct and exists in the system.
    2. Check Policy Creation: If the policy is supposed to exist, verify that it has been created and activated in the system. You can do this by navigating to the relevant transaction or using the appropriate report to list existing policies.
    3.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the policy. You may need to consult with your SAP security team to verify user roles and permissions.
    4. Database Consistency: If you suspect data inconsistency, you may need to run consistency checks or consult with your SAP Basis team to investigate any underlying database issues.
    5. Consult Documentation: Review SAP documentation or notes related to policy management and migration for any specific instructions or known issues.
    6.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ists and you cannot identify the cause,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ance.
